PRS In Vivo USA rebrands following investment

M&A News North America Retail

US – Shopper research company PRS In Vivo USA has rebranded to Behaviorally after a majority investment from asset management group Alcentra.

Formerly part of French research and consulting company BVA Group, PRS In Vivo USA has been acquired by Alcentra. PRS In Vivo Europe and Asia are still part of BVA Group.

BVA Group entered into receivership last year. Last week ( 13th January) the group’s management team and its main shareholder Naxicap (known as XPage) were given approval to acquire the company by the French appeals court.

PRS In Vivo was formed in 2016 when New Jersey-based Perception Research Services (PRS) merged with French agency In Vivo. The company conducts behavioural research focused on packaging and shopper marketing. 

Alex Hunt, global chief executive of PRS In Vivo (pictured), will continue to lead the company, along with all members of the US executive leadership team.

Alcentra’s Alex Walker, Nicolas Besson and Jean-Charles Deudon have joined the board of Behaviorally as non-executive directors.

Hunt said: “With the substantial and stable backing of funds managed by Alcentra as new majority shareholder, we are excited to launch our new brand, Behaviorally, under a digital-first strategy that responds to our client’s growth challenges. At the same time, all of our clients can continue to expect the same high level of service, deep-domain and behavioural insights expertise for which PRS is known.”

The terms of the investment have not been disclosed.
